Anyway, Im getting bilstein b8s and eibach pro springs installed in my 6 soon and would like some advice on camber/toe settings once lowered.. I will probably put spc adjustable ball joints in so I can adjust front camber. I have read some people saying bushings are required as well? Will I have issues if I just put in the ball joints over time?

    I have followed this thread and they are basically saying:
    Front and rear total toe-in at .09 deg +/- .04 deg (.04" +/- .02" @ tire).
    Rear camber -1.6 deg +/- .2 deg.
    Front camber -1.2 deg +/- .2 deg.

    Doing a quick bit of reading on here it appears maybe I should aim for 0.00 for front and rear toe and around -1 deg for front and rear camber?

    Now, I have no idea about suspension, but does anyone else have values I should be aiming for once I get a proper alignment? I am running oem rims, 225/45 18 tyres. I do not track the car and doubt I will be doing so in the future so its just a dd.
    I should note I did notice quite a bit of inner tire wear on my front tyres before I replaced them so Im assuming camber is out.

    a little bit of toe in stops the car from tram tracking and decreases straight line speed but increase's stability but does effect the ability to turn the car a bit @ speed eg understeer
    Neutral toe is fastest in a straight line due to less rolling friction on the tyre's but does get a bit unstable at hi-speed and it will tram track a bit it but will handle well through the corners
    toe out can cause oversteer but also can increase a car turning capabilities making it twitchy but like "toe in" decreases straight line speed and increases stability

    Digging this back up, got a quick alignment done and I will definately need the SPC ball joints (eventually).
    Given the specs I gave them, came out to:
    -0.1mm toe all round
    front camber -0.35 l/r (way off, should be at least -1 but need spc ball joints to adjust, was sitting at 0 before lowering the car)
    rear camber -1.3 l/r
    Aiming for -1.2f and -1.5r once I get a re-alignment with the spc ball joints.
